Highbury House Sees Some Profit Growth, But Below Expectations

UK publishing group, Highbury House Communications, this morning said that it is still on target to improve profits for the full year, despite the continuing poor conditions in the business advertising market. Nevertheless, profits are still likely to be ‘somewhat lower’ than current market forecasts.

The consumer publishing division has continued to perform well in the second half of the year, generating good revenue growth from both advertising and newsstand sales.

The group says that budgets for next year have been prepared on the assumption of continuing difficult advertising conditions, particularly in the business sector. The consumer sector, on the other hand, is predicted to show additional growth, resulting from “the ongoing development of key products and greater newsstand sales efficiencies.”

Highbury says that these factors, together with the full year benefit of cost reductions achieved in the current year, should ensure that 2003 will be another year of growth.

Shares in Highbury House were down by 0.25p at 11.75p by mid-morning today.
